Maker(s):Unknown
Culture:Indian
Title:Figure of seated Ganesha
Date Made:19th century
Type:Sculpture
Materials:Bronze
Place Made:Asia; India
Measurements:Overall: 1 1/2 in x 1 in x 5/8 in; 3.8 cm x 2.5 cm x 1.6 cm; Base: 1/2 in x 5/8 in x 1/4 in; 1.3 cm x 1.6 cm x .6 cm
Accession Number:  MH 1921.1.O.G
Credit Line:Gift of Reverend William Greenwood in memory of Julia B. Greenwood (Class of 1862)
Museum Collection:  Mount Holyoke College Art Museum
mh_1921_1_o_g_v1_01.jpg

Description:
Elephant-headed, four-armed, large-bellied deity seated on square base of four tiers; details incised
